A mother and baby elephant stand together in quiet harmony, their forms shaped with gentle movement and warm, earthy tones. The mother’s presence is steady and protective, her silhouette grounding the scene, while the calf leans close, echoing her rhythm with soft, tentative steps. Light glides across their textured skin, revealing the wisdom, tenderness, and unspoken bond between them.
In this moment, strength and vulnerability form an intimate portrait of love, guidance, and the enduring grace of the wild.

My artwork, predominantly using oil-on-canvas, takes me beyond everyday routine and into a world of boundless creativity, to further develop my artistic eye. I am strongly influenced by nature and wildlife and often focus on vast land and seascapes, whilst my architectural precision and contemporary imagination truly distinguish and define my work.
I am drawn to the restless beauty of seascapes, the quiet poetry of nature, and the spirit of animals. My work seeks to capture movement and colour in their most evocative form. Layers of texture, shifting light, and brushstrokes that carry the pulse of the natural world.
I playfully exaggerate my subjects with the use of vibrant colours and accumulation of layers, creating textured surfaces and a poly-dimensional reality that adds both depth and light to my work instantly setting my work apart.
I have been part of Tadworth Art Group for the past 7 years and have exhibited at Epsom Surrey Art Fair for the past 3 years.
A dark horse races through the night, its mane and muscles captured in a blur of movement and energy. Shadows and moonlight play across its powerful form, highlighting the tension, grace, and raw freedom of the animal.
Through textured brushstrokes and layered oils, the painting conveys both speed and strength, evoking the mystery and wildness of a creature in its untamed element.

A sweeping oil canvas holds two identical horses, poised like mirrored spirits, facing one another in silent communion. Their forms rise from the brushstrokes as if summoned from mist, with muscles carved in amber light, coats shimmering with the soft glow of dawn. Their manes drift backward like dark silk caught in a gentle wind, each strand painted with the tender patience of an artist listening to the heartbeat of the scene.
Between them lies a breath of stillness, a narrow space trembling with unspoken meaning, a pause where twin souls recognize themselves. In their symmetry there is balance, in their likeness a kind of ancient whisper, and in their gaze a calm, eternal knowing.

Crashing waves meet rugged cliffs in a dramatic display of nature’s power and beauty. The sea churns with movement and colour—deep blues, foaming whites, and fleeting hints of sunlight—while the cliffs stand steadfast, etched with texture and time.
Through layered brushstrokes, the painting captures the tension between motion and solidity, the wild energy of the ocean, and the quiet strength of the land, inviting viewers to feel both awe and serenity.

A tiger steps from the shadows; its gaze fierce and penetrating; every muscle and stripe alive with tension and movement. The darkness around it heightens its presence, making the animal’s colours and form almost luminous against the night.
Through textured brushwork and dynamic strokes, the painting captures both the raw power and silent grace of this magnificent predator, evoking a moment of quiet intensity and primal beauty.
